#import "RTCRtpCodecParameters+Private.h"
#import "RTCMediaStreamTrack.h"
#import "helpers/NSString+StdString.h"
#include "media/base/media_constants.h"
#include "rtc_base/checks.h"
const NSString *const kRTCRtxCodecName = @(webrtc::kRtxCodecName);
const NSString *const kRTCRedCodecName = @(webrtc::kRedCodecName);
const NSString *const kRTCUlpfecCodecName = @(webrtc::kUlpfecCodecName);
const NSString *const kRTCFlexfecCodecName = @(webrtc::kFlexfecCodecName);
const NSString *const kRTCOpusCodecName = @(webrtc::kOpusCodecName);
const NSString *const kRTCL16CodecName = @(webrtc::kL16CodecName);
const NSString *const kRTCG722CodecName = @(webrtc::kG722CodecName);
const NSString *const kRTCPcmuCodecName = @(webrtc::kPcmuCodecName);
const NSString *const kRTCPcmaCodecName = @(webrtc::kPcmaCodecName);
const NSString *const kRTCDtmfCodecName = @(webrtc::kDtmfCodecName);
const NSString *const kRTCComfortNoiseCodecName =
@(webrtc::kComfortNoiseCodecName);
const NSString *const kRTCVp8CodecName = @(webrtc::kVp8CodecName);
const NSString *const kRTCVp9CodecName = @(webrtc::kVp9CodecName);
const NSString *const kRTCH264CodecName = @(webrtc::kH264CodecName);
@implementation RTC_OBJC_TYPE (RTCRtpCodecParameters)
@synthesize payloadType = _payloadType;
@synthesize name = _name;
@synthesize kind = _kind;
@synthesize clockRate = _clockRate;
@synthesize numChannels = _numChannels;
@synthesize parameters = _parameters;
- (instancetype)init {
webrtc::RtpCodecParameters nativeParameters;
return [self initWithNativeParameters:nativeParameters];
}
- (instancetype)initWithNativeParameters:
(const webrtc::RtpCodecParameters &)nativeParameters {
self = [super init];
if (self) {
_payloadType = nativeParameters.payload_type;
_name = [NSString stringForStdString:nativeParameters.name];
switch (nativeParameters.kind) {
case webrtc::MediaType::AUDIO:
_kind = kRTCMediaStreamTrackKindAudio;
break;
case webrtc::MediaType::VIDEO:
_kind = kRTCMediaStreamTrackKindVideo;
break;
default:
RTC_DCHECK_NOTREACHED();
break;
}
if (nativeParameters.clock_rate) {
_clockRate = [NSNumber numberWithInt:*nativeParameters.clock_rate];
}
if (nativeParameters.num_channels) {
_numChannels = [NSNumber numberWithInt:*nativeParameters.num_channels];
}
NSMutableDictionary *parameters = [NSMutableDictionary dictionary];
for (const auto &parameter : nativeParameters.parameters) {
[parameters setObject:[NSString stringForStdString:parameter.second]
forKey:[NSString stringForStdString:parameter.first]];
}
_parameters = parameters;
}
return self;
}
- (webrtc::RtpCodecParameters)nativeParameters {
webrtc::RtpCodecParameters parameters;
parameters.payload_type = _payloadType;
parameters.name = [NSString stdStringForString:_name];
// NSString pointer comparison is safe here since "kind" is readonly and only
// populated above.
if (_kind == kRTCMediaStreamTrackKindAudio) {
parameters.kind = webrtc::MediaType::AUDIO;
} else if (_kind == kRTCMediaStreamTrackKindVideo) {
parameters.kind = webrtc::MediaType::VIDEO;
} else {
RTC_DCHECK_NOTREACHED();
}
if (_clockRate != nil) {
parameters.clock_rate = std::optional<int>(_clockRate.intValue);
}
if (_numChannels != nil) {
parameters.num_channels = std::optional<int>(_numChannels.intValue);
}
for (NSString *paramKey in _parameters.allKeys) {
std::string key = [NSString stdStringForString:paramKey];
std::string value = [NSString stdStringForString:_parameters[paramKey]];
parameters.parameters[key] = value;
}
return parameters;
}
@end
